A 45-45 90 triangle has two lengths that are equal, and the hypotenuse is √2 times those lengths.
Therefore:
Let x = the length of a leg (doesn't matter which one, they are equal)
√2 * x = 24 Divide both sides by √2
x = 24 / √2
To get the radical out of the denominator, multiply the right side by √2/√2
x = 24√2 / 2
x = 12√2 Answer is B
